Tim Hortons Roll up the rim to win

I will explain what this is before I rant about it.

Tim Hortons Inc. is a Canadian coffee-and-doughnut fast food restaurant chain. The store rapidly expanded across Canada to become the country's largest quick-service food chain.

From late February until early May of each year, Tim Hortons holds a very large marketing campaign called Roll Up The Rim to Win. Over thirty million prizes are distributed each year, ranging in value from vehicles to televisions, to store products. Customers determine if they have won prizes by unrolling the rim on their paper cup when they have finished their drink, revealing their luck underneath.

Has anyone ever won anythingworth more than a free donut or a coffee? If you look at the official rules here http://www.rolluptherimtowin.com/ there are supposed to be 1in 10 chances of winning. I purchase at least 2 coffees in the morning for my brother and myself. Some days, I would get upto 10 of them for of my employees and maybe buy a few more at around 15:00 coffee break. That's about a dozen chances a day and this year so far, I gotten 1 free coffee and 1 free donut. I really don't care much for the small prizes and really don't expect to win the car or big prize, but why do all these sweepstakes give out exaggerated percentages on winning? I guess it's an advertising gimmick to get coffee sales up during the slowest business months.
